Add rdu3 DB names to conditionals in postgresql_server tasks.
Signed-off-by: James Antill <james@and.org>
This commit is contained in:
parent
34a0144950
commit
f446135409
1 changed files with 8 additions and 6 deletions
|
@ -138,19 +138,21 @@
|
||||||
|
|
||||||
- name: Copy over backup scriplet
|
- name: Copy over backup scriplet
|
||||||
ansible.builtin.copy: src=backup-database dest=/usr/local/bin/backup-database mode=0755
|
ansible.builtin.copy: src=backup-database dest=/usr/local/bin/backup-database mode=0755
|
||||||
when: not inventory_hostname.startswith(('db-koji01.iad2','db-datanommer'))
|
when: not inventory_hostname.startswith(('db-koji01.iad2', 'db-koji01.rdu3', 'db-datanommer'))
|
||||||
tags:
|
tags:
|
||||||
- postgresql
|
- postgresql
|
||||||
|
|
||||||
|
# Main koji is _big_ so we don't keep multiple copies of backups, so special
|
||||||
|
# backup script. Smaller koji's are fine with the default N backups.
|
||||||
- name: Copy over backup scriplet
|
- name: Copy over backup scriplet
|
||||||
ansible.builtin.copy: src=backup-database.db-koji01 dest=/usr/local/bin/backup-database mode=0755
|
ansible.builtin.copy: src=backup-database.db-koji01 dest=/usr/local/bin/backup-database mode=0755
|
||||||
when: inventory_hostname.startswith('db-koji01.iad2')
|
when: inventory_hostname.startswith(('db-koji01.iad2', 'db-koji01.rdu3'))
|
||||||
tags:
|
tags:
|
||||||
- postgresql
|
- postgresql
|
||||||
|
|
||||||
- name: Copy over backup scriplet
|
- name: Copy over backup scriplet
|
||||||
ansible.builtin.copy: src=backup-database.db-datanommer02 dest=/usr/local/bin/backup-database mode=0755
|
ansible.builtin.copy: src=backup-database.db-datanommer02 dest=/usr/local/bin/backup-database mode=0755
|
||||||
when: inventory_hostname.startswith('db-datanommer02.iad2')
|
when: inventory_hostname.startswith(('db-datanommer02.iad2', 'db-datanommer02.rdu3'))
|
||||||
tags:
|
tags:
|
||||||
- postgresql
|
- postgresql
|
||||||
|
|
||||||
|
@ -158,13 +160,13 @@
|
||||||
ansible.builtin.copy: src=backup-database.anitya dest=/usr/local/bin/backup-database.anitya mode=0755
|
ansible.builtin.copy: src=backup-database.anitya dest=/usr/local/bin/backup-database.anitya mode=0755
|
||||||
tags:
|
tags:
|
||||||
- postgresql
|
- postgresql
|
||||||
when: inventory_hostname.startswith('db01.phx2') or inventory_hostname.startswith('db01.iad2')
|
when: inventory_hostname.startswith(('db01.iad2', 'db01.rdu3'))
|
||||||
|
|
||||||
- name: Copy over anitya public backup cron
|
- name: Copy over anitya public backup cron
|
||||||
ansible.builtin.copy: src=cron-backup-anitya-public dest=/etc/cron.d/cron-backup-anitya-public mode=0644
|
ansible.builtin.copy: src=cron-backup-anitya-public dest=/etc/cron.d/cron-backup-anitya-public mode=0644
|
||||||
tags:
|
tags:
|
||||||
- postgresql
|
- postgresql
|
||||||
when: inventory_hostname.startswith('db01.iad2')
|
when: inventory_hostname.startswith(('db01.iad2', 'db01.rdu3'))
|
||||||
|
|
||||||
- name: Set up some cronjobs to backup databases as configured
|
- name: Set up some cronjobs to backup databases as configured
|
||||||
ansible.builtin.template: >
|
ansible.builtin.template: >
|
||||||
|
@ -188,4 +190,4 @@
|
||||||
- GBDR
|
- GBDR
|
||||||
|
|
||||||
- import_tasks: datanommer.yml
|
- import_tasks: datanommer.yml
|
||||||
when: inventory_hostname.startswith('db-datanommer02.iad2') or (env == "staging" and inventory_hostname.startswith('db-datanommer01.stg'))
|
when: inventory_hostname.startswith('db-datanommer')
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ue